Mass Outages After Michigan Storms | Lansing News
Thunderstorms slammed southern Michigan, plunging nearly 400,000 homes into darkness—Wayne County hit hardest with over 129,000 outages. Power companies are racing to restore service, deploying crews—including out-of-state teams—to tackle the damage. DTE expects 95% of customers back by Monday, while Consumers Energy works 16-hour shifts to get everyone reconnected safely. With the holiday weekend adding pressure, residents are urged to stay clear of downed lines and report outages immediately. Keep checking local providers for updates as crews push to restore power.
